 While over-the-counter medications are readily available, many people seek natural alternatives to manage their pain.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 Herbal remedies have been used for centuries to alleviate headaches and migraines and offer gentle yet effective relief.
 </p>
</p></div>
<p> <!-- heading: supported --></p>
<h2 class="heading-h2 replaced-h1" id="nav-ring-4">
 3 simple herbal remedies for headaches and migraines<br />
 </h2>
</p>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 Here are three simple herbal remedies that can help soothe these common afflictions:
 </p>
</p></div>
<p> <!-- heading: supported --></p>
<h3 class="heading-h3 replaced-h1" id="nav-ring-6">
 1. Peppermint oil<br />
 </h3>
</p>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 Peppermint oil is renowned for its refreshing scent and potent analgesic properties. It contains menthol, which helps relax muscles and reduce pain.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 Applying peppermint oil topically can immediately relieve tension headaches and migraines.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Pain relief</strong>: Menthol acts as a natural pain reliever and muscle relaxant.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Improved circulation</strong>: Enhances blood flow, which can alleviate headache symptoms.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Aromatherapy</strong>: The invigorating scent can help clear the mind and reduce stress.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-image ">
<p> <!-- image: supported --></p>
<div class="imageBlock aligment-center">
<div>
<p> <span class="image-holder" data-fancybox="images-cc128489-cd7c-4c16-9dfa-7e2af9b6e614" data-caption="Peppermint oil [Medical News Today]"></p>
<picture style="--noscript-src: url(https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/k4SktkpTURBXy85YTJkMjgxM2QxZWJkMDc0OWMxZDEwZDcxZjg2YmY1Ny5qcGeRlQLNAxbNAgTCww); " class="image-wrapper"><source data-original="https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/jfHk9kpTURBXy85YTJkMjgxM2QxZWJkMDc0OWMxZDEwZDcxZjg2YmY1Ny5qcGeRlQLNAxbNAgTCw94AAqEwBqExAA" srcset="https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/jfHk9kpTURBXy85YTJkMjgxM2QxZWJkMDc0OWMxZDEwZDcxZjg2YmY1Ny5qcGeRlQLNAxbNAgTCw94AAqEwBqExAA" type="image/avif"><source data-original="https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/88hk9kpTURBXy85YTJkMjgxM2QxZWJkMDc0OWMxZDEwZDcxZjg2YmY1Ny5qcGeRlQLNAxbNAgTCw94AAqEwBaExAA" srcset="https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/88hk9kpTURBXy85YTJkMjgxM2QxZWJkMDc0OWMxZDEwZDcxZjg2YmY1Ny5qcGeRlQLNAxbNAgTCw94AAqEwBaExAA" type="image/webp"><img width="790" height="516" alt="Peppermint oil [Medical News Today]" title="Peppermint oil [Medical News Today]" class="image lazyloaded imgWithMetaData" src="data:image/svg+xml;charset=utf8,%3Csvg%20xmlns%3D'http%3A%2F%2Fwww.w3.org%2F2000%2Fsvg'%20width%3D'790'%20height%3D'516'%20data-ring-placeholder%3D'1'%3E%3C%2Fsvg%3E" data-original="https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/k4SktkpTURBXy85YTJkMjgxM2QxZWJkMDc0OWMxZDEwZDcxZjg2YmY1Ny5qcGeRlQLNAxbNAgTCww" fetchpriority="low" decoding="async" loading="lazy"/></source></source></picture>
 </span></p></div>
</p></div>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Topical application:</strong> Dilute a few drops of peppermint oil with a carrier oil (such as coconut or jojoba oil) and gently massage it onto your temples, forehead, and the back of your neck.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Inhalation</strong>: Add a few drops of peppermint oil to a bowl of hot water and inhale the steam, or use a diffuser to disperse the aroma in your environment.
 </p>
</p></div>
<p> <!-- heading: supported --></p>
<h3 class="heading-h3 replaced-h1" id="nav-ring-17">
 2. Ginger<br />
 </h3>
</p>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 Ginger is a versatile herb known for its powerful anti-inflammatory and anti-nausea properties. It has been used for centuries to treat various ailments, including headaches and migraines.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 Consuming ginger can help reduce inflammation and pain, making it a valuable remedy for migraine sufferers.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Anti-inflammatory</strong>: Reduces inflammation that can trigger migraines.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Pain relief</strong>: Blocks prostaglandins, substances that cause pain and inflammation.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Digestive aid</strong>: Helps alleviate nausea often associated with migraines.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Ginger tea</strong>: Slice fresh ginger root and steep it in hot water for 10-15 minutes. Strain and drink the tea, adding honey or lemon for taste if desired.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Ginger supplements</strong>: Take ginger capsules or chew ginger candies as a convenient alternative to fresh ginger.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Ginger compress</strong>: Soak a cloth in warm ginger tea and apply it to your forehead for a soothing compress.
 </p>
</p></div>
<p> <!-- heading: supported --></p>
<h3 class="heading-h3 replaced-h1" id="nav-ring-28">
 3.Feverfew<br />
 </h3>
</p>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 Feverfew is a herb traditionally used to prevent and treat migraines. It contains parthenolide, a compound that helps reduce the frequency and severity of migraine attacks.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 Regular use of feverfew can be an effective strategy for managing chronic migraines.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Migraine prevention</strong>: Reduces the occurrence and intensity of migraines over time.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Anti-inflammatory</strong>: Helps lower inflammation that can trigger migraines.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Vasodilation</strong>: Improves blood flow by preventing the constriction of blood vessels in the brain.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-image ">
<p> <!-- image: supported --></p>
<div class="imageBlock aligment-center">
<div>
<p> <span class="image-holder" data-fancybox="images-3e2ce4ee-dbbd-443d-a1bb-0eafa9ba3cfe" data-caption="Feverfew tea [Kailash Herbs]"></p>
<picture style="--noscript-src: url(https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/8GXktkpTURBXy84NzgxYmJkMDdiM2VkMzNhMzJlOTBlODJmMWJjYmFjNi5qcGeRlQLNAfPNAUzCww); " class="image-wrapper"><source data-original="https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/Kock9kpTURBXy84NzgxYmJkMDdiM2VkMzNhMzJlOTBlODJmMWJjYmFjNi5qcGeRlQLNAfPNAUzCw94AAqEwBqExAA" srcset="https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/Kock9kpTURBXy84NzgxYmJkMDdiM2VkMzNhMzJlOTBlODJmMWJjYmFjNi5qcGeRlQLNAfPNAUzCw94AAqEwBqExAA" type="image/avif"><source data-original="https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/HVik9kpTURBXy84NzgxYmJkMDdiM2VkMzNhMzJlOTBlODJmMWJjYmFjNi5qcGeRlQLNAfPNAUzCw94AAqEwBaExAA" srcset="https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/HVik9kpTURBXy84NzgxYmJkMDdiM2VkMzNhMzJlOTBlODJmMWJjYmFjNi5qcGeRlQLNAfPNAUzCw94AAqEwBaExAA" type="image/webp"><img width="499" height="332" alt="Feverfew tea [Kailash Herbs]" title="Feverfew tea [Kailash Herbs]" class="image lazyloaded imgWithMetaData" src="data:image/svg+xml;charset=utf8,%3Csvg%20xmlns%3D'http%3A%2F%2Fwww.w3.org%2F2000%2Fsvg'%20width%3D'499'%20height%3D'332'%20data-ring-placeholder%3D'1'%3E%3C%2Fsvg%3E" data-original="https://ocdn.eu/pulscms-transforms/1/8GXktkpTURBXy84NzgxYmJkMDdiM2VkMzNhMzJlOTBlODJmMWJjYmFjNi5qcGeRlQLNAfPNAUzCww" fetchpriority="low" decoding="async" loading="lazy"/></source></source></picture>
 </span></p></div>
</p></div>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Feverfew tea</strong>: Steep dried feverfew leaves in hot water for 10 minutes. Strain and drink the tea daily.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211; <strong>Feverfew supplements</strong>: Available in capsule or tablet form, these can be taken according to the dosage instructions on the package.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 &#8211;<strong>Feverfew leaves</strong>: Chew a few fresh Feverfew leaves daily, though this may not be suitable for everyone due to the bitter taste.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 Herbal remedies offer a natural and effective way to manage headaches and migraines. Peppermint oil, ginger, and feverfew are three simple yet powerful herbs that can provide relief from pain and discomfort.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 Adding these remedies into your routine can help reduce the frequency and intensity of headaches or migraines and improve your overall quality of life.
 </p>
</p></div>
<div class="ringCommonDetail ringBlockType-paragraph ">
<p> <!-- paragraph: supported --></p>
<p>
 As with any treatment, it is important to consult with a healthcare professional before starting any new regimen, especially if you have underlying health conditions or are taking other medications.
